我们正在使用ECMAScript 6 promises.
我们需要向最终用户实施进度通知(这是纯UX要求).我知道其他的promise框架(例如,Q promise库)允许这样做.
我们怎样才能最优雅地采用某种进步指示?
或者我们应该迁移到不同的框架?(我不知道如何评估后者的努力)
我想知道为什么媒体查询的优先级低于普通的CSS?如何解决以使媒体查询更重要?
@media screen and (min-width: 100px) and (max-width: 1499px) {
.logo img {
width: 120%;
}
}
.logo img{
width: 100%;
}Run Code Online (Sandbox Code Playgroud)
<div class="logo">
<a href="/#!/"><img src="http://www.menucool.com/slider/jsImgSlider/images/image-slider-2.jpg" alt="image"></a>
</div>Run Code Online (Sandbox Code Playgroud)
我正在从字符串中删除一个字符,如下所示:
S = "abcd"
Index=1 #index of string to remove
ListS = list(S)
ListS.pop(Index)
S = "".join(ListS)
print S
#"acd"
Run Code Online (Sandbox Code Playgroud)
我确信这不是最好的方法.
编辑 我没有提到我需要操纵长度为~10 ^ 7的字符串大小.所以关心效率很重要.
有人能帮我吗.哪种pythonic方式呢?
我正在尝试在浏览器上运行离子项目,但默认端口8000已在使用中.
我需要改变端口
我正在使用此命令:
ionic run browser --port 8002
Run Code Online (Sandbox Code Playgroud)
但它不起作用.
该文件说,port 选项是--port | -p
谢谢
我在hdfs中有一个表pos.pos_inv,由yyyymm分区.以下是查询:
select DATE_ADD(to_date(from_unixtime(unix_timestamp(Inv.actvydt, 'MM/dd/yyyy'))),5),
to_date(from_unixtime(unix_timestamp(Inv.actvydt, 'MM/dd/yyyy'))),yyyymm
from pos.pos_inv inv
INNER JOIN pos.POSActvyBrdg Brdg ON Brdg.EIS_POSActvyBrdgId = Inv.EIS_POSActvyBrdgId
where to_date(from_unixtime(unix_timestamp(Inv.nrmlzdwkenddt, 'MM/dd/yyyy')))
BETWEEN DATE_SUB(to_date(from_unixtime(unix_timestamp(Inv.actvydt, 'MM/dd/yyyy'))),6)
and DATE_ADD(to_date(from_unixtime(unix_timestamp(Inv.actvydt, 'MM/dd/yyyy'))),6)
and inv.yyyymm=201501
Run Code Online (Sandbox Code Playgroud)
我已将查询的分区值提供为201501,但仍然出现错误"
Error while compiling statement: FAILED: SemanticException [Error 10041]: No partition predicate found for Alias "inv" Table "pos_inv"
Run Code Online (Sandbox Code Playgroud)
(schema)分区,yyyymm是int类型,actvydt是日期存储为字符串类型.
我期待使用ES6语法创建一个主导入文件.我有一个带有index.js文件的组件目录.
export如果有意义,我想进口.本质上,我想导入然后导出单个组件文件到索引文件,所以我可以imports从任何其他文件解构我,如下所示:
import {Comp1, Comp2} from "./components"
Run Code Online (Sandbox Code Playgroud)
如何使用ES6语法执行此操作?
我知道如何directive在子指令的link函数中获取父控制器.
但是,我宁愿避免使用link函数(和$scope所有在一起),并controller在指令的功能下拥有我的所有代码.
angular.directive('parent', function(){
return {
templateUrl: '/parent.html',
scope: true,
bindToController: true,
controllerAs: 'parentCtrl',
controller: function(){
this.coolFunction = function(){
console.log('cool');
}
}
}
});
angular.directive('child', function(){
return {
templateUrl: '/child.html',
require: '^parent',
scope: true,
bindToController: true,
controllerAs: 'childCtrl',
controller: function() {
// I want to run coolFunction here.
// How do I do it?
}
}
});
Run Code Online (Sandbox Code Playgroud)
任何帮助表示赞赏!
我正在尝试进行此查询:
SELECT * FROM TABLEA AS A WHERE YEAR(A.dateField)='2016'
Run Code Online (Sandbox Code Playgroud)
我怎样才能在续集风格中执行上面的查询?
TABLEA.findAll({
where:{}//????
}
Run Code Online (Sandbox Code Playgroud)
谢谢!
我正在为Gmail和其他邮件编写一个HTML/CSS电子邮件模板.但是,Gmail不会加载<style>块,因此我必须使用内联"样式"属性才能使其正常工作.
为了说明问题:
<style>
.center {
text-align:center;
}
</style>
<a class="center"> text </a>
Run Code Online (Sandbox Code Playgroud)
转换为:
<a class="center" style="text-align:center;"> text </a>
Run Code Online (Sandbox Code Playgroud)
这里有没有人知道更好的方法或任何程序吗?
我有一个看起来像这样的Django模型:
class MyModel(Model):
field_1 = IntegerField()
field_2 = IntegerField()
field_3 = IntegerField()
value = IntegerField()
time_stamp = DateTimeField()
Run Code Online (Sandbox Code Playgroud)
我想找到所有(field1, field2, field3)元组组合的最新条目,并value从该行中获取值.
例如,假设表格中包含以下行:
Field1, Field2, Field3, TimeStamp, Value
1 , 1 , 1 , 1/1/2015 , 1
1 , 1 , 1 , 1/2/2015 , 2
1 , 1 , 2 , 1/1/2015 , 3
2 , 2 , 2 , 1/1/2015 , 4
Run Code Online (Sandbox Code Playgroud)
我希望我的查询结果返回2,3,4 行
我显然可以这样做:
dims = MyModel.objects.values('field1', 'field2', 'field3').distinct()
for dim in dims: …Run Code Online (Sandbox Code Playgroud)